Prestigious Neighborhood Attractions

Beacon Hill is not only known for its luxurious apartments and amenities but also for its prestigious neighborhood attractions. The charming brick-lined streets, historic sites and museums, boutique shops, upscale restaurants, and proximity to downtown Boston make Beacon Hill an attractive destination for both tourists and locals alike.

One of the most iconic and popular attractions in Beacon Hill is the Massachusetts State House, which overlooks the Boston Common. This historic building has been the home of the state government since 1798 and features impressive architecture, beautiful gardens, and a fascinating history. Visitors can take a free guided tour to learn more about the building’s architecture and history.

For those interested in art and culture, Beacon Hill offers several world-class museums such as The Museum of African American History, Nichols House Museum, and The Gibson House Museum. These museums showcase various exhibitions depicting the lives of early settlers and luminaries who contributed to shaping the culture of Boston.

Beacon Hill is also home to several stunning parks such as Louisburg Square Park and Boston Public Garden. Louisburg Square Park is known for its stunning townhouses lined up on all four sides that add a touch of beauty to this well-maintained public park. On the other hand, Boston Public Garden is famous for its enchanting Swan Boats that glide through the lagoons surrounded by trees, flowers, and statues.

Scenic Views and Historic Charm

One of the main draws of living in Beacon Hill is the neighborhood’s scenic views and historic charm. The streets are lined with 19th-century brownstone buildings, many of which have been converted into luxury apartments and townhouses. These elegant homes feature classic architectural details such as ornate ironwork, bay windows, high ceilings, and fireplaces.

Beacon Hill is also home to several picturesque parks and open spaces. The most famous of these is Boston Common, a 50-acre park that offers stunning views of the city skyline. In the summer, the Common becomes a hub for outdoor concerts, festivals, and community events. The nearby Public Garden is another beautiful green space that features flower beds, fountains, and swan boats to rent for a leisurely cruise on the lagoon.

The neighborhood’s narrow streets add to its historic charm. Many of them are made of cobblestone and are lined with gas lamps that date back to the 1800s. Walking down these streets feels like stepping back in time. Despite its old-world feel, Beacon Hill has plenty of modern amenities such as high-end restaurants and boutique shops.

Boston Beacon Hill 2nd Quarter 2022 rental stats

What was the number of Boston Beacon Hill apartments rented in the 3rd Q 2022?

244 Beacon Hill apartments were rented in the 3rd Q 2021

What was the average living area of a rented Beacon Hill apartment?

The average living area of a Boston Beacon Hill apartment is 597 sq. ft.

What was the avg. list price of a Beacon Hill apartment in the 3rd Q 2021?

The avg. list price was $2,873 for a Beacon Hill apartment

What were the average days on the market for a Beacon Hill apartment in the 2nd Q 2022?

38 days on the market before being rented

What was the average rented price of Beacon Hill apartment in the 2nd Q 2022?

The average rented price was $2,870.00 for a Beacon Hill apartment in the 2nd Q 2022
